How to Make Delicious Spaghetti Carbonara: A Step-by-Step Guide

Spaghetti carbonara is a classic Italian dish that is easy to make and tastes absolutely amazing. With a combination of simple ingredients and a few key techniques, you too can create this delicious pasta dish in your own home. Follow this step-by-step guide to learn how to make spaghetti carbonara.

Ingredients:

– 1 pound spaghetti

– 6 ounces pancetta or bacon, diced

– 4 large eggs

– 1 cup freshly grated Pecorino Romano cheese

– 1/2 cup freshly grated Parmesan cheese

– 2 cloves garlic, minced

– 1/4 teaspoon black pepper

– Salt, to taste

Instructions:

1. Cook spaghetti in a large pot of boiling salted water until al dente, according to package instructions. Reserve 1/2 cup of pasta water, then drain the spaghetti and set aside.

2. Meanwhile, in a large skillet over medium heat, cook the pancetta or bacon until crispy and golden brown, about 8 to 10 minutes. Using a slotted spoon, transfer pancetta to a plate lined with paper towels to drain.

3. In a medium bowl, whisk together the eggs, Pecorino Romano cheese, Parmesan cheese, garlic, black pepper, and a pinch of salt until well combined.

4. Add the drained spaghetti to the skillet with the pancetta and toss to combine. Remove the skillet from the heat and let cool for a minute.

5. Gradually pour the egg mixture over the spaghetti, tossing quickly and continuously until the pasta is coated and the sauce has thickened, adding reserved pasta water if necessary to thin out the sauce.

6. Season to taste with additional salt and black pepper, if needed. Serve immediately, garnished with additional grated cheese and chopped parsley, if desired.

Tips:

– It’s important to remove the skillet from the heat before adding the egg mixture to prevent the eggs from scrambling.

– Whisking the egg mixture vigorously helps to incorporate air, resulting in a lighter and fluffier sauce.

– Reserve some pasta water to use in case the sauce becomes too thick, but don’t add too much or the sauce will become watery.

– For a vegetarian version, skip the pancetta or bacon and use sautéed mushrooms instead.
